Vernor & Hood Poultry
Fashion Plate, 'Walking Dress/Full Dress.' for 'Lady's Monthly Museum'July 1, 1805

Not on view
Hand-colored engraving of two Regency-era women in full-length fashionable dress, one seen from behind in a patterned shawl and parasol bonnet, one in profile in a rose-pink high-waisted gown
